#5eb334 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5eb334 is composed of 36.9% red, 70.2%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.9%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 100.2 degrees, a saturation of 55% and a lightness of 45.3%. #5eb334 color hex could be obtained by blending #bcff68 with #006700.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#5eb334

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060c03 is the darkest color, while #fcf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#5eb334

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#737572 is the less saturated color, while #4fdf08 is the most saturated one.
